Hi r/AIProteins,

StructureViewer has been updated. You can now create interactive molecular structure posts directly on Reddit by pasting raw structure text.

What’s new

  • Supports PDB, CIF/mmCIF, XYZ, and SDF
  • Better protein chain coloring
  • DNA/RNA bases now get different colors
  • Small molecules use atom-based colors
  • Cleaner preview card in the feed
  • Full viewer opens with Open 3D Viewer

How to create a post

  1. Go to the subreddit menu.
  2. Click Create Structure Viewer Post.
  3. Add your Reddit post title.
  4. Add optional body text for notes or context.
  5. Choose your structure format: PDB, CIF/mmCIF, XYZ, or SDF.
  6. Paste the raw contents of your structure file into Structure text.
  7. Optionally set protein chain colors, for example: A=#5ec4e0.
  8. Choose dark or light background.
  9. Submit the form.

Use PDB or CIF/mmCIF for proteins, complexes, DNA/RNA, and structural biology files.

Use XYZ or SDF for small molecules and chemistry structures.

After posting, users will see a structure preview. Click Open 3D Viewer to rotate, zoom, inspect, and recolor chains.
